I would get out and see how hard the dirt is outside that puddle (in general) and gun it first gear (even automatics let you choose a lower gear usually.

Make sure you take traction control off and get a running start if you stopped close to the puddle.

If you’re going 30 or 40 and don’t slow down and ignore the huge bumps and vibrations, you’ll make it thru. Afterwards keep going past the puddle and don’t slow down till you dry turn around. If on rare occasions there is none, don’t turn around on the grass, reverse the whole way 40 mph.

The grass could look fine but I guarantee the grass is 10x worse than the puddle.

In my experience the dually step-vans seem to float above the mud if you go fast enough since you have more surface area from the extra tires. Just don’t slow down
